SX59 ADO is a 2010 Mazda CX-7 in Black with a 2,184cc diesel engine. This vehicle has been through 16 MOT tests with a personal pass rate of 68.8%.
Across all 2010 Mazda CX-7 models, the average MOT pass rate is 74.2% with a typical mileage of 74,147 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Mazda CX-7 fails its MOT is track rod end ball joint has excessive play, accounting for 1,334 recorded failures. If you're considering buying SX59 ADO, it's worth having these areas checked by a mechanic before committing.
The Mazda CX-7 typically stays on UK roads for around 19 years. At 16 years old, this Mazda CX-7 is approaching the upper end of the typical lifespan for this model.
